Accounts Receivable Period
The accounts receivable period measures the average number of days it takes for a company to collect payments after a sale has been made, indicating the efficiency of its credit and collection policies.
Receivables Period
The mean duration required for a company to collect payments from its customers for products or services supplied on credit.
Credit Policy Decisions
Strategic determinations made by a business regarding who qualifies for credit, the terms of credit, credit limits, and how to collect on overdue accounts.
Controller
A senior financial officer responsible for managing the accounting operations of a company.
